Abstract

The invention provides a ball joint device, comprising a ball joint part and a connecting part, the ball joint part has a first spherical joint part, and the first spherical joint part has a first surface; the connecting part has a first receiving part, a first The fixing part, the first arc surface and the second arc surface, the first receiving part cooperates with the first fixing part so that the first spherical joint part is rotatably arranged on the connecting part; wherein, when the first spherical joint When the portion is disposed on the connecting portion, the first arc surface and the second arc surface interfere with the first surface respectively, and the first arc surface and the second arc surface do not match. In this way, the problem of uneven force caused by component tolerances can be overcome.

Description

technical field [0001] The invention relates to the field of mechanical active connections, in particular to a connection structure with ball joints. Background technique [0002] At present, the ball joint is generally composed of a fixed piece, a movable adjustment ring and an adjustment screw. The passive manual adjustment screw is used to generate friction to achieve a 360-degree free rotation of the ball joint while having a fast connection effect. , to rotate and can be relatively fixed in a certain state. However, the above-mentioned structure may have the problem of loosening of the adjustment screw and a reduction in the friction force after long-term use, and repeated adjustments must be made manually, which is a problem for devices that do not need to change the torque.
